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Schachbrett Hintergrund

Forumthread: Schachbrett Hintergrund

Schachbrett Hintergrund
10.01.2003 14:31:38
daniel
Kann ich ohne (zeile mod 2) jede zweite zeile automatisch zB grau färben, das dauert nämlich sehr lange weil ich das ganze excelsheet durchgehen muß?

Danke, Daniel

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Schachbrett Hintergrund
10.01.2003 14:34:54
andreas e
hallo daniel,
wie wäre es so:
'Jede ungerade Zeile wir Grau hinterlegt, bei jeder geraden die Farbformatierung gelöscht.
Sub JedeZweiteZeileGrau()
Start = 3 ' Start erst ab dieser Zeile
lZeile2 = Cells(Rows.Count, 1).SpecialCells(xlLastCell).Row
For i = Start To lZeile2
If i Mod 2 = 1 Then
Rows(i).Interior.ColorIndex = 15
Else
Rows(i).Interior.ColorIndex = xlNone
End If
Next i
End Sub
gruß
andreas e
Anzeige
Re: Schachbrett Hintergrund
10.01.2003 14:38:33
Ramses
Hallo Daniel,

es ist die Frage ob es wirklich das ganze Sheet sein muss, denn das ist eine Formatierung und EXCEL will unter Umständen alles ausdrucken,... das sind dann schon ein paar Seiten.

Nimm stattdessen die Bedingte Formatierung:

Das ganze Sheet markieren

1. Bedingung:
Formel= "=Rest(Zeile();2)=0"
Muster zuweisen

2. Bedingung:
Formel= "Rest(Spalte();2)=0"
Muster zuweisen


oder via VBA:

Geht beides sehr schnell

Gruss Rainer

Anzeige
Re: Schachbrett Hintergrund
10.01.2003 16:01:54
daniel
Vielen Dank. Das geht echt superschnell!!
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18